코딍코딍
코딩기록
코딍코딍
전체 방문자
오늘
어제
  • 분류 전체보기 (271)
    • 개발 (2)
    • Java (1)
    • 스프링 (28)
    • JPA (11)
    • Git (3)
    • 알고리즘 (160)
      • 백준 (132)
      • 프로그래머스 (8)
      • SWEA (20)
    • 토이 프로젝트 (14)
      • 간단한 Springboot CRUD (1)
      • 게시판 프로젝트 (13)
    • 알고리즘 개념정리 (8)
    • 오류 해결 (13)
    • 보류 (0)
    • AWS (5)
    • 트러블 슈팅 (0)
    • 회고 (3)
    • CS (4)

블로그 메뉴

  • 홈
  • 태그
  • 방명록

공지사항

최근 글

티스토리

hELLO · Designed By 정상우.
코딍코딍

코딩기록

알고리즘/백준

[백준] 2468번 : 안전 영역

2024. 1. 22. 21:28

https://www.acmicpc.net/problem/2468

 

2468번: 안전 영역

재난방재청에서는 많은 비가 내리는 장마철에 대비해서 다음과 같은 일을 계획하고 있다. 먼저 어떤 지역의 높이 정보를 파악한다. 그 다음에 그 지역에 많은 비가 내렸을 때 물에 잠기지 않는

www.acmicpc.net

 

해결 방법

문제 해결을 위해 BFS를 사용하였다.

비가 와서 물에 잠기는 범위는 0~100이다.

고로 물에 잠기는 0부터 100까지의 모든 경우를 BFS를 통해 확인하여 안전한 영역의 최대 개수를 구해주면 된다.

BFS 할 때 주의할 점은 같은 정점을 다시 방문하지 않기 위해 방문 처리를 해줘야 하고 물에 잠긴 영역을 탐색하면 안 된다.

 

'알고리즘 > 백준' 카테고리의 다른 글

[백준] 21608번 : 상어 초등학교  (0) 2024.01.28
[백준] 13549번 : 숨바꼭질 3  (0) 2024.01.23
[백준] 11660번 : 구간 합 구하기 5  (0) 2024.01.22
[백준] 12018번 : Yonsei TOTO  (1) 2024.01.21
[백준] 1890번 : 점프  (0) 2024.01.19
    '알고리즘/백준' 카테고리의 다른 글
    • [백준] 21608번 : 상어 초등학교
    • [백준] 13549번 : 숨바꼭질 3
    • [백준] 11660번 : 구간 합 구하기 5
    • [백준] 12018번 : Yonsei TOTO
    코딍코딍
    코딍코딍
    ㅎ2

    티스토리툴바